On 13/01/18 06:06, wm4 wrote: > In addition, this does not allow creating frames contexts with sw_format > for which no known transfer formats exist. In theory, we should check > whether the chroma format (i.e. the sw_format) is supported at all by > the vdpau driver, but checking for transfer formats has the same effect. > > Note that the pre-existing code adds 1 to priv->nb_pix_fmts[i] for > unknown reason, and some checks need to account for that to check for > empty lists. They are not off-by-one errors. > --- > libavutil/hwcontext_vdpau.c | 55 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++------------- > 1 file changed, 39 insertions(+), 16 deletions(-) > > diff --git a/libavutil/hwcontext_vdpau.c b/libavutil/hwcontext_vdpau.c > index 9b8f839647..c11c3cfdab 100644 > --- a/libavutil/hwcontext_vdpau.c > +++ b/libavutil/hwcontext_vdpau.c > @@ -79,11 +79,12 @@ static const VDPAUPixFmtMap pix_fmts_444[] = { > > static const struct { > VdpChromaType chroma_type; > + enum AVPixelFormat frames_sw_format; > const VDPAUPixFmtMap *map; > } vdpau_pix_fmts[] = { > - { VDP_CHROMA_TYPE_420, pix_fmts_420 }, > - { VDP_CHROMA_TYPE_422, pix_fmts_422 }, > - { VDP_CHROMA_TYPE_444, pix_fmts_444 }, > + { VDP_CHROMA_TYPE_420, AV_PIX_FMT_YUV420P, pix_fmts_420 }, > + { VDP_CHROMA_TYPE_422, AV_PIX_FMT_YUV422P, pix_fmts_422 }, > + { VDP_CHROMA_TYPE_444, AV_PIX_FMT_YUV444P, pix_fmts_444 }, > }; > > static int count_pixfmts(const VDPAUPixFmtMap *map) > @@ -170,6 +171,35 @@ static void vdpau_device_uninit(AVHWDeviceContext *ctx) > av_freep(&priv->pix_fmts[i]); > } > > +static int vdpau_frames_get_constraints(AVHWDeviceContext *ctx, > + const void *hwconfig, > + AVHWFramesConstraints *constraints) > +{ > + VDPAUDeviceContext *priv = ctx->internal->priv; > + int nb_sw_formats = 0; > + int i; > + > + constraints->valid_sw_formats = av_malloc_array(FF_ARRAY_ELEMS(vdpau_pix_fmts) + 1, > + sizeof(*constraints->valid_sw_formats)); > + if (!constraints->valid_sw_formats) > + return AVERROR(ENOMEM); > + > + for (i = 0; i < FF_ARRAY_ELEMS(vdpau_pix_fmts); i++) { > + if (priv->nb_pix_fmts[i] > 1) > + constraints->valid_sw_formats[nb_sw_formats++] = vdpau_pix_fmts[i].frames_sw_format; > + } > + constraints->valid_sw_formats[nb_sw_formats] = AV_PIX_FMT_NONE; > + > + constraints->valid_hw_formats = av_malloc_array(2, sizeof(*constraints->valid_hw_formats)); > + if (!constraints->valid_hw_formats) > + return AVERROR(ENOMEM); > + > + constraints->valid_hw_formats[0] = AV_PIX_FMT_VDPAU; > + constraints->valid_hw_formats[1] = AV_PIX_FMT_NONE; > + > + return 0; > +} > + > static void vdpau_buffer_free(void *opaque, uint8_t *data) > { > AVHWFramesContext *ctx = opaque; > @@ -214,26 +244,18 @@ static int vdpau_frames_init(AVHWFramesContext *ctx) > > int i; > > - switch (ctx->sw_format) { > - case AV_PIX_FMT_YUV420P: priv->chroma_type = VDP_CHROMA_TYPE_420; break; > - case AV_PIX_FMT_YUV422P: priv->chroma_type = VDP_CHROMA_TYPE_422; break; > - case AV_PIX_FMT_YUV444P: priv->chroma_type = VDP_CHROMA_TYPE_444; break; > - default: > - av_log(ctx, AV_LOG_ERROR, "Unsupported data layout: %s\n", > - av_get_pix_fmt_name(ctx->sw_format)); > - return AVERROR(ENOSYS); > - } > - > for (i = 0; i < FF_ARRAY_ELEMS(vdpau_pix_fmts); i++) { > - if (vdpau_pix_fmts[i].chroma_type == priv->chroma_type) { > + if (vdpau_pix_fmts[i].frames_sw_format == ctx->sw_format) { > + priv->chroma_type = vdpau_pix_fmts[i].chroma_type; > priv->chroma_idx = i; > priv->pix_fmts = device_priv->pix_fmts[i]; > priv->nb_pix_fmts = device_priv->nb_pix_fmts[i]; > break; > } > } > - if (!priv->pix_fmts) { > - av_log(ctx, AV_LOG_ERROR, "Unsupported chroma type: %d\n", priv->chroma_type); > + if (priv->nb_pix_fmts < 2) { I think keeping the (equivalent) older check of !priv->pix_fmts would look slightly clearer? > + av_log(ctx, AV_LOG_ERROR, "Unsupported sw format: %s\n", > + av_get_pix_fmt_name(ctx->sw_format)); > return AVERROR(ENOSYS); > } > > @@ -468,6 +490,7 @@ const HWContextType ff_hwcontext_type_vdpau = { > #endif > .device_init = vdpau_device_init, > .device_uninit = vdpau_device_uninit, > + .frames_get_constraints = vdpau_frames_get_constraints, > .frames_init = vdpau_frames_init, > .frames_get_buffer = vdpau_get_buffer, > .transfer_get_formats = vdpau_transfer_get_formats, > LGTM in any case. (Yeah, the nb_pix_fmts thing is very confusing. I had to read that several times...) - Mark

I don't think that would be the same. Checking priv->pix_fmts tells you that there was a matching chroma type, but checking nb_pix_fmts < 2 tells you in addition whether there is any working sw_format. That in turn is needed to tell whether the vdpau implementation supports the chroma format at all.
